Behavioral Health, Clinician
J.R. has a Master of Human Services degree and a Master of Professional Counseling degree, both from the University of Great Falls in Great Falls, Mont. Myers has worked in Soldotna, Homer and Montana, and he is a former vice president of the Alaska Counseling Association and former president of the Kenai Peninsula Counseling Association. He is a licensed professional counselor and regional behavioral health supervisor in Haines.
J.R.'s medical interests include trauma and healing, role recovery, strength-based therapy and patient advocacy. He also enjoys art, nature, learning and community involvement.
